如何为实现接口的类创建构造函数

时间:2016-11-29 02:03:05

标签: php oop constructor interface constants

我要求创建一个名为Wall的具体类,它从Color接口实现,并且确保它有一个构造函数和一个属性"。

问题是我不确定如何在PHP中使用C#或Java创建构造函数。

我不确定我的代码中出错了什么,但是你去了:

interface Color
{
    const CONSTANT = "some constant variable";
    public function someMethod();
}

class Wall implements Color
{
    public $color;

    public function someMethod()
    {
        echo "method implemented";
    }

    public function __construct($color)
    {
        $this->$color = $color;
    }
}

BTW,指令要求接口有一个常量和方法。

0 个答案:

没有答案